February is going to be one crazy, busy month for our Clan.
I knew the only way we were going to have dinner at home together was if I came up with a plan for the month. Since I had the list to start from, it really only took a few minutes to decide which dinners we could make.
Here’s what I am not doing:
- I am not expecting the plan to go exactly the way it is on paper right now
- I am not trying any new, elaborate main dishes this month
- I am not planning on eating out any night for dinner
Here’s what I am doing:
- I am repeating one dish three times through the month
- I am planning most meals around meat we already have on hand
- I am planning a few easy dinners: slow cook, breakfast
- I am mixing a few styles into the month: Mexican, Chinese, American, Italian
- I am trying a few new side dishes, breakfast foods, and snacks
